Reviews
"This triangular board book is engagingly designed to fit in little hands. Each page turn offers a diamond-shaped double-page spread that asks youngsters to guess an animal based on the sound it makes. "Who says meow?" queries a cheerful blue spread. And here's where it gets fun: the answer is found by unfolding the pages, transforming the spread into a whiskered cat's face, with perky triangle ears. The pattern repeats to reveal 11 vividly painted animals by book's end, including a turkey, snake, pig, sheep, and peacock. Sturdily constructed, this clever book will withstand grabbing and multiple reading sessions." -- Booklist, "Top 5 For Under 5. A board book that's a triangle! This follow-up to Peek-a-Who is full of hidden animals, each making different sounds. Can you figure out who each one is? Lift the unique shaped flaps to see who peeks out! Babies and toddlers are sure to be delighted by these colorful, noisy creatures." -- Princeton Library, "Best and Brightest Board Books of 2019. Exquisite. The small, triangular book fits well in little hands, and young readers will enjoy opening the flaps up and down to see who makes each sound.
